IMPACT OF BIPEDALISM. “The reduction of the olfactory mucosa seen in humans is strongly associated with the adaptive shift of a quadropedal locomotion gait to bipedality. Homo erectus is considered the first committed biped in our evolutionary history, which required the repositioning of the foramen magnum (a more anterior inferior placement) in order to balance the skull over the vertebral column and accommodate erect posture.”
